CDN(Content Delivery Network,内容分发网络)技术的核心目标是提高网站访问速度,确保内容的快速加载和高可用性,通过在不同地理位置部署多个服务器节点,CDN存储静态资源如图片、视频和其他类型的文件,在用户请求时从最近的节点提供服务,以此减少延迟,下面将围绕此问题展开详细分析:
1、访问速度的提升
全球分布的节点:CDN服务商通常会在全球多个大流量城市设立服务器节点,这些节点相互连接,形成了一个高速的专用网络,使得数据可以在地理上更为接近用户的地方被快速访问。
就近访问原则:这是CDN的基础原则之一,即通过将数据部署在靠近用户的地点,来大幅降低请求的时延,理想情况下可以趋近于零。
网站性能提升:快速的访问速度不仅改善了用户体验,还能提高网站的性能评分,对于搜索引擎优化(SEO)也有正面影响。
2、支持频繁的用户互动
更新:CDN确保了即使网站内容频繁更新,用户也总能获得最新版本,因为内容变更可以即时同步至所有节点。
动态加速功能:除了静态内容的加速外,一些CDN还提供动态内容的加速服务,以应对数据库调用、API接口等更加复杂的应用场景。
3、无障碍的网站浏览
跨运营商的优化:CDN能够跨越不同运营商和网络服务提供商的障碍,为用户提供稳定的访问质量。
应对高并发情况:在访问高峰时期,CDN通过负载均衡技术分散请求压力,避免服务器过载导致的网站无法访问。
4、全球用户考量
国际化业务拓展:对于目标市场涉及多个国家和地区的网站,使用CDN可以保证全球用户的访问体验基本一致。
异地备份:CDN节点之间的内容同步机制,能够在源服务器出现问题时提供异地备份,增强数据的可靠性。
5、成本效益分析
节约带宽成本:通过缓存和边缘服务器的分布式处理,减少了源站的带宽需求,从而可以节省成本。
按需付费模式:许多CDN服务商提供按需付费的服务模式,用户可以根据实际使用量支付费用,避免了资源的浪费。
6、安全性增强
DDoS攻击防护:CDN能够有效识别并防御分布式拒绝服务攻击(DDoS),保护网站安全。
数据传输加密:在数据从CDN节点传输到用户的过程中,支持SSL/TLS加密,确保数据传输的安全性。
7、便捷的运维管理
集中式管理:CDN提供集中式的管理平台,方便网站管理员对内容分发进行监控和调整。
日志分析和监控:CDN服务商通常还会提供日志分析服务,帮助网站管理员了解用户行为,优化网站结构。
8、对搜索引擎的影响
改善SEO效果:快速的加载速度是搜索引擎排名的重要因素之一,CDN的加速效果有助于提升网站的搜索排名。
提高用户留存率:由于访问速度的提升,用户更倾向于停留在加载速度快的网站上,降低了跳出率。
在进一步考虑相关因素后,人们认识到CDN服务并非完美无缺,根据用户反馈,某些CDN服务商可能不提供免费额度,对于个人博客或小型站长来说或许成本较高,CDN服务的选型也应关注其节点的数量和分布、服务的可靠性、技术支持的及时性等。
CDN加速服务为网站带来的益处显而易见,包括但不限于访问速度的显著提升、支持频繁用户互动的能力、实现无障碍浏览、考虑全球用户访问体验、成本效益的优势、安全性的增强以及便捷的运维管理,选择合适的CDN服务商也需要仔细权衡成本与服务之间的关联,以及预期的效果是否能够满足特定网站的需求。
相关问答FAQs
Q1: CDN加速适用于哪些类型的网站?
A1: CDN加速尤其适用于那些含有大量静态内容(如图片、视频等)的网站、需要面向全球用户提供服务的国际网站、以及追求高性能和高可用性的电商平台和新闻门户,对于那些需要频繁更新内容和高互动性的网站,如社交媒体和在线游戏,CDN同样能提供显著的加速效果。
Q2: 如何评估CDN服务商的性价比?
A2: 评估CDN服务商的性价比时,需要考虑多个因素,包括服务商提供的节点数量和地理位置、服务的可靠性和稳定性、技术支持的响应时间和质量、额外的安全功能、以及价格结构,价格结构不仅包括成本本身,还要考虑是否包含额外服务如SSL/TLS加密、DDoS攻击防护等,综合以上因素后,选择投入产出比最高的服务商。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/975814.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复